Morocco Authorizes TUI Fly to Operate Special Flights from Belgium for Citizens and Residents

TUI fly is preparing to operate special flights between Belgium and Morocco from August 27 to September 10.
In a press release, the Belgian airline "TUI fly" announced that it "has received authorization from the Moroccan government to operate these flights between Brussels South Charleroi and Casablanca, Oujda and Al Hoceima".
According to the company, these special flights are reserved for Moroccan citizens currently in Europe. They will thus be able to return to their country of origin, it is specified.
They are also planned for MREs with permanent residence in Europe, who will be able to return to Belgium on the return flight.
In addition, PCR tests are required before boarding these exceptional flights, with the exception of children under 11 years of age.
